First of all, it is necessary to explain what affiliate marketing is before we can get into pay per click affiliates. Affiliate marketing is a way that businesses, especially online ones, can market their products and services at a minimal cost to themselves. This is done by creating several clickable ads, depicting their products or services, that will direct anyone who clicks on them back to that business’s site. This is a great way to have marketing without the huge expense of more traditional means. Of course, there has to be a place to put these ads, and that is where the host sites come in. These sites offer to have these ads placed on their sites for a small fee that the business pays them. This is usually through the pay per click method.
With pay per click affiliates, when the ads are placed on the site, an agreement is made between the business and the host site about how the host site should be paid. In many cases, both of these parties will be part of an affiliate ring, and so they would follow the guidelines of that particular ring, and might never meet face-to-face, or at least never speak directly. Most of the time these payment arrangements are made on a pay per click basis. This means that the business pays the host site any time that someone clicks away from the host site and goes to the business’s site. Usually the pay outs are quite small; so many sites will have many different ads on their site to make it worth their while. Of course, over time it can get to be quite expensive for the business, which is why some have chosen to have other pay out methods.
That’s how pay per click affiliates work, in a nutshell. It is simple, but there are unique elements to the process that can make it seem harder. For a business, affiliate marketing is a great advertising method; for a host site, it is an easy way to turn a small time-investment into an ongoing income source. This is why affiliate marketing is so popular on both sides of the fence.
